What is Campus ASP?
Campus ASP operates as a cornerstone of youth engagement in Brooklyn, NY, specifically targeting the Flatbush, Crown Heights, and Flatlands neighborhoods. By providing a comprehensive suite of services that includes summer camp experiences for children aged 5-15 and structured after-school programs for ages 5-13, the company bridges the gap between academic support and recreational enrichment. Their model, which emphasizes safety, homework assistance, and regional excursions, has established them as a reliable partner for local families seeking high-quality extracurricular programming. How much funding has Campus ASP raised?
Campus ASP has raised a total of $58K across 1 funding round:
Debt
$58K
Debt (2021): $58K with participation from PPP
